Filene Research Institute Organization Description

Filene Research Institute strengthens organizations through innovative research and incubation to improve consumer financial well-being. As an independent cooperative finance think tank, Filene’s membership network connects a community of leaders and bright minds to change lives through innovation, truth, and cooperation. In addition to delivering cutting-edge, actionable academic research, Filene also provides incubators to test and scale solutions, events to spark organizations into action and advisory services to help accelerate and implement innovation. 

For more information, visit filene.org and @fileneresearch.

We live by the famous words of our namesake, credit union and retail pioneer Edward A. Filene: "Progress is the constant replacing of the best there is with something still better." Together, Filene and our thousands of supporters seek progress for credit unions by turning questions into research, research into ideas, and ideas into action. Filene is a 501(c)(3) not-for-profit organization. 

 

Job Purpose

The Incubation Intern will work closely with the Incubation team, helping them to expand programs by focusing on increasing the number of credit unions that join the Lab as Lab Sponsors, building relationships, and finding new opportunities. The ideal candidate will have experience with finding and assessing sales leads, creating sales and account relationships, exploring new market opportunities, producing communications materials, and handling team administrative tasks. We are looking for a driven, independent person who is passionate about cooperative finance and who thrives in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.

 

Job Responsibilities

  • Opportunity Cultivation
    • Proactively identify and research credit unions with a keen interest in innovation to build and qualify the Lab Sponsorships pipeline for the Lab at Filene.
    • Assist in outreach to prospective sponsors, supporting the scheduling of discussions and ensuring comprehensive tracking within Salesforce for effective follow-up and engagement.
    • Collaborate closely with the Incubation team to refine and implement top-tier relationship management practices for Lab Sponsors.
  • Market Differentiation and Go-To-Market Materials
    • Partner with the Incubation and Marketing teams to craft compelling go-to-market sales communication resources that resonate with the target audience.
    • Engage with the Incubation and Membership teams to pinpoint the defining characteristics and personas of ideal Lab Sponsor organizations, ensuring a tailored approach to market engagement.  
  • New Market Strategy
    • Collaborate with the Incubation team to investigate new market opportunities, aiming to expand Lab sponsorships across diverse sectors such as leagues, foundations, fintechs, and more. 
  • Additional Responsibilities
    • Lead select team administrative duties to help maintain organization and project management (e.g. notetaking, agenda management, etc.).
    • Expand understanding of consumer and cooperative finance, practice the basics of research in financial services, and build portfolio-worthy projects.
